Cybersecurity Ventures predicts that the global cost of cybercrime it will surpass $10.5 trillion annually in 2025.

When it comes to consumers, they’re being targeted more often, and with more advanced strategies that use AI, leaked data, and social engineering to make scams harder to spot.

Scams no longer just involve phishing emails with obvious typos or fake lottery winnings. Today’s fraudsters use AI, data harvesting, and social engineering to make scams look more authentic. They know how to craft messages that trick even the most experienced consumers into clicking on harmful links or entering their sensitive data into fake websites.

The hardest part of falling for a scam isn’t just the financial loss, it’s the feeling of being outmaneuvered, of realizing too late that the signs were there, hidden in plain sight.

Guardio, developers of an advanced browser extension and mobile app designed to protect you from a wide range of online threats across all your devices, explains how to protect yourself from scams and cybercrime, in a Entrepreneur article.
